The 2000s was a strange, but magical time. Everyone wore really large and tacky clothing and called it fashion. The Kardashiansweren't dominating the news cycle. Destiny's Child was still a thing! Basically, the world was a better place.

Mariah Carey was still killing it, rappers were actually rapping and American Idol winners were seamlessly breaking into the industry. It was a simpler time. It was an iconic decade.

With all of this goodness, we also had AMAZING music (AND amazing music videos). In fact, most of these songs are so iconic that they can be identified almost immediately by a simple chord, note or badass intro. With this being said, it was a real TASK to narrow this list down to 20 songs, but I pushed through the hardship and compiled some of the cream of the crop.

This is the best of the best, regardless of genre, style or Band-Aid fashion statements (I'm looking at you, Nelly). Take a short, but sweet, stroll down memory lane with me. In no particular order, except for Beyoncé being number one, here are the 20 best songs of the 2000s:
